|  | /* Lightweight function to convert a frequency (in Mhz) to a channel number. */ | 
|  | static inline u8 b43_freq_to_channel_5ghz(int freq) | 
|  | { | 
|  | return ((freq - 5000) / 5); | 
|  | } | 
|  | static inline u8 b43_freq_to_channel_2ghz(int freq) | 
|  | { | 
|  | u8 channel; | 
|  |  | 
|  | if (freq == 2484) | 
|  | channel = 14; | 
|  | else | 
|  | channel = (freq - 2407) / 5; | 
|  |  | 
|  | return channel; | 
|  | } | 
|  |  | 
|  | /* Lightweight function to convert a channel number to a frequency (in Mhz). */ | 
|  | static inline int b43_channel_to_freq_5ghz(u8 channel) | 
|  | { | 
|  | return (5000 + (5 * channel)); | 
|  | } | 
|  | static inline int b43_channel_to_freq_2ghz(u8 channel) | 
|  | { | 
|  | int freq; | 
|  |  | 
|  | if (channel == 14) | 
|  | freq = 2484; | 
|  | else | 
|  | freq = 2407 + (5 * channel); | 
|  |  | 
|  | return freq; | 
|  | } |
